A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

package cn.itheima.puke;

import java.util.ArrayList;
import java.util.Collections;


public class PuKe {

        public static void main(String[] args) {
                ArrayList<String> hs = new ArrayList<String>();
                hs.add("黑桃A");
                hs.add("黑桃2");
                hs.add("黑桃3");
                hs.add("黑桃4");
                hs.add("黑桃5");
                hs.add("黑桃6");
                hs.add("黑桃7");
                hs.add("黑桃8");
                hs.add("黑桃9");
                hs.add("黑桃10");
                hs.add("黑桃J");
                hs.add("黑桃Q");
                hs.add("黑桃K");
                hs.add("红桃A");
                hs.add("红桃2");
                hs.add("红桃3");
                hs.add("红桃4");
                hs.add("红桃5");
                hs.add("红桃6");
                hs.add("红桃7");
                hs.add("红桃8");
                hs.add("红桃9");
                hs.add("红桃10");
                hs.add("红桃J");
                hs.add("红桃Q");
                hs.add("红桃K");
                hs.add("梅花A");
                hs.add("梅花2");
                hs.add("梅花3");
                hs.add("梅花4");
                hs.add("梅花5");
                hs.add("梅花6");
                hs.add("梅花7");
                hs.add("梅花8");
                hs.add("梅花9");
                hs.add("梅花10");
                hs.add("梅花J");
                hs.add("梅花Q");
                hs.add("梅花K");
                hs.add("方块A");
                hs.add("方块2");
                hs.add("方块3");
                hs.add("方块4");
                hs.add("方块5");
                hs.add("方块6");
                hs.add("方块7");
                hs.add("方块8");
                hs.add("方块9");
                hs.add("方块10");
                hs.add("方块J");
                hs.add("方块Q");
                hs.add("方块K");
                hs.add("小王");
                hs.add("大王");
                Collections.shuffle(hs);
                ArrayList<String> al1 = new ArrayList<String>();
                ArrayList<String> al2 = new ArrayList<String>();
                ArrayList<String> al3 = new ArrayList<String>();
                ArrayList<String> al4 = new ArrayList<String>();
                for (int i = 0; i < 3; i++) {
                        al1.add(hs.get(i));
                }
                for(int i =3;i<20;i++){
                        al2.add(hs.get(i));
                }
                for(int i =20;i<37;i++){
                        al3.add(hs.get(i));
                }
                for(int i =37;i<54;i++){
                        al4.add(hs.get(i));
                }
                System.out.println("底牌是:"+al1);
                System.out.println("林妹妹的牌是:"+al2);
                System.out.println("大D的牌是:"+al3);
                System.out.println("刘鹏的牌是:"+al4);
               
               
               
               
        }

}

7 个回复

倒序浏览
有何作用?
回复 使用道具 举报
楼主很强,保持你的耐心
回复 使用道具 举报

安慰下自己!我还能听懂~~
回复 使用道具 举报
真心佩服楼主这么努力
回复 使用道具 举报
佩服佩服,一个发牌的程序。
回复 使用道具 举报
顶一个 学习了
回复 使用道具 举报
楼主真是厉害的一塌糊涂
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马